Ingredient-list length is a descriptive property of the label, not a safety rating. A longer list is not automatically worse and a shorter one is not automatically better; the count is shown so the label can be placed against a comparable population. The comparison here runs against the 27,084 Condiments products we publish with a parsed label, not against the whole catalogue, because list length varies far more between categories than within one.

Full Ingredient List

Cheddar cheese powder (cheddar cheese [milk, salt, cheese cultures, enzymes], whey, buttermilk, salt, cream, sodium phosphate, lactic acid, color [annatto, yellow 5 lake, yellow 6 lake], natural flavors, soy lecithin), dextrose, imitation bacon bits (textured soy flour, hydrogenated soybean oil [with bht as a preservative], salt, natural and artificial flavors, caramel color, red 40), onion powder, garlic powder, whey, maltodextrin, salt, spice, torula yeast, dehydrated chives and green onion, yeast extract, bacon flavor (contains bacon fat), natural flavors (contains milk), calcium stearate added to prevent caking, sunflower oil, natural smoke flavor, disodium inosinate, disodium guanylate, citric acid. topping: bread crumbs (bleached wheat flour, sugar, yeast, partially hydrogenated soybean oil, salt), salt, partially hydrogenated soybean & cottonseed oil, garlic powder, dehydrated red bell pepper, spices, oleoresin paprika, silicon dioxide (anti-caking).
